Select all | Attribute | Value |
---|---|---|
Brand | Microchip | |
Family Name | AVR XMEGA | |
Package Type | TQFP | |
Mounting Type | Surface Mount | |
Pin Count | 64 | |
Device Core | AVR | |
Data Bus Width | 8 bit, 16bit | |
Program Memory Size | 384 + 8 kB | |
Maximum Frequency | 32MHz | |
RAM Size | 32 kB | |
USB Channels | 0 | |
Number of PWM Units | 1 | |
Number of SPI Channels | 5 | |
Typical Operating Supply Voltage | 1.6 → 3.6 V | |
Number of CAN Channels | 0 | |
Number of USART Channels | 3 | |
Number of I2C Channels | 2 | |
Number of UART Channels | 3 | |
Dimensions | 14.1 x 14.1 x 1.05mm | |
Minimum Operating Temperature | -40 °C | |
Pulse Width Modulation | 1 (18 Channel) | |
Instruction Set Architecture | RISC | |
Maximum Number of Ethernet Channels | 0 | |
ADCs | 16 x 12 bit | |
Number of PCI Channels | 0 | |
Number of Ethernet Channels | 0 | |
Width | 14.1mm | |
Number of LIN Channels | 0 | |
Maximum Operating Temperature | +85 °C | |
Number of ADC Units | 1 | |
Height | 1.05mm | |
Program Memory Type | Flash | |
Length | 14.1mm | |

8/16-Bit AVR XMEGA Microcontrollers
Atmel AVR XMEGA devices employ advanced analogue-to-digital converters (ADCs) that deliver both high speed and high resolution. These ADCs offer up to four conversion channels with different result registers, which can have different setup and configuration processes. This provides easier use since different software modules can access and use an ADC independently.
AVR XMEGA devices use the Atmel AVR CPU. The instruction set and design of the CPU are tuned to minimize code size and maximize execution speed. Its true single-cycle execution of arithmetic and logic operations means AVR XMEGA microcontrollers perform close to 1MIPS per MHz. The fast-access register file with 32 x 8-bit general-purpose working registers is directly connected to the arithmetic logic unit (ALU). During a single clock cycle, the ALU can be fed two arbitrary registers, do a requested operation, and write back the result. It provides efficient support for 8-, 16- and 32-bit arithmetic.
